Grand Island Chamber of Commerce: State of the Town forum Jan. 30

Sat, Jan 11th 2020 07:00 am

The Grand Island Chamber of Commerce has announced the second annual State of the Town and Schools event.

The event will be held on Thursday, Jan. 30, from 10 to 11:45 a.m. at the Buffalo Launch Club, located at 503 East River Road.

According to the chamber, “At this point in history it is as important as ever for the business community to be actively involved and well represented before our town government and school district. This event is an excellent opportunity to hear what each has planned for the future, as well as have your questions answered and voices heard. It is also a great chance for our local businesses to do a little networking and build relationships that help us get to know each other better. Building stronger relationships certainly will contribute to future success. Given these things, we ask that you really make an effort to join us at this event!”

For chamber members, the admission charged is waived for up to two guests from the organization. Additional guests or those who are not Chamber of Commerce members will have the $15 admission charge apply.

Grand Island Town Supervisor John Whitney, Superintendent of Schools Brian Graham, and Chamber of Commerce President Eric Fiebelkorn will have 15 minutes to present the plans for the upcoming year; a question and answer period will follow. To submit questions, email to [email protected] by Jan. 29 and the question will be asked on your behalf at the event. Those who plan to attend can submit questions at the registration table.

Light refreshments will be served.
